Yio Chu Kang appears to be a hub for schools and private estates alone from a distance. However, there’s more to it than you think up close. It’s located in the North-Eastern part of Singapore.

The once riverside kampong’s name came from early Chinese settlers. Translated, it means (Yio/Yeo) family owns the house (chu) located along the river (kang). Its complete transformation into a modern estate started in the 80s. Heading there on holiday? Here are some things to do in Yio Chu Kang you should try:

5. Enjoy Watching Turtles and Tortoises at The Live Tortoise and Turtle Museum

Love turtles and tortoises? The Live Tortoise and Turtle Museum has enough of the reptiles to satisfy your interest. 

The facility has over a hundred species of the creatures, which you can watch and learn about from a safe distance. Feel free to take pictures of and pet and hand feed some of the cuties!
